Veeva is building the industry cloud for Life Sciences through software, data, AI, and business consulting working together. Learn more about our products, vision, values, and status as a Public Benefit Corporation (PBC) on our website. Consulting is changing, and we’re not like other firms. Launched in 2019, Veeva Business Consulting has grown quickly and organically to over 500 global experts who combine deep domain knowledge with innovative technology to help Life Sciences companies work in a more efficient and connected way. We are growing aggressively as we look towards 2030. We are seeking great people to help shape the future of the industry with the world’s leading software, data, AI, and expertise at their back. The Role As a Principal Consultant in our Global Content Practice, you will help customers bring treatments to patients faster by transforming how they work with Technology, Data, and AI. You will focus on reshaping operating models, driving organizational change, and measuring tangible business value. You will have the opportunity to shape new ways of working in the end-to-end content operating model – from incorporating AI into a tier-based MLR process, to refining content creation strategy through Claims and Modular Content. These processes and tools help customers get personalized, impactful content to market faster, allowing them to quickly communicate important information to HCPs and patients.
